AttributeError: 'list' object has no attribute 'to_csv'
时间: 2023-06-22 19:20:26 浏览: 341
这个错误是因为在Python中,列表(list)类型没有to_csv()方法。to_csv()是pandas库中DataFrame类型的方法,用于将数据保存为CSV文件。如果你想将一个列表保存为CSV文件,需要先将其转换为DataFrame类型,然后再使用to_csv()方法。可以使用以下代码将列表转换为DataFrame类型并保存为CSV文件:
```python
import pandas as pd
my_list = [1, 2, 3, 4, 5]
df = pd.DataFrame(my_list, columns=['my_column_name'])
df.to_csv('my_csv_file.csv', index=False)
```
这将会将my_list保存到my_csv_file.csv文件中,并且不会在CSV文件中添加索引列。
相关问题
attributeerror: 'list' object has no attribute 'to_csv'
这个错误是因为列表对象没有to_csv属性。to_csv是pandas库中DataFrame对象的方法,用于将数据写入CSV文件。如果你想将列表写入CSV文件,需要先将列表转换为DataFrame对象,然后再使用to_csv方法。
AttributeError: 'NoneType' object has no attribute 'to_csv'
AttributeError: 'NoneType' object has no attribute 'to_csv'表示在某个None对象上调用了to_csv方法,但是该对象并没有这个属性或方法。通常,出现这个错误的原因有以下几种情况:
1. 对象为None:如果一个变量被赋值为None,那么它就是一个特殊的NoneType对象,它没有任何属性或方法。所以当你在None对象上调用一个不存在的属性或方法时,就会出现AttributeError。
2. 函数没有返回值:有时候,一个函数可能没有明确的返回值,或者返回的是None。当你试图在函数的返回值上调用属性或方法时,就会出现AttributeError。
为了解决这个错误,你可以采取以下措施:
1. 确保对象不是None:在使用一个对象之前,先检查它是否为None。你可以使用条件语句来判断对象是否为None,然后再进行相应的操作。
2. 检查函数的返回值:如果你在调用一个函数后使用返回的值,确保函数有明确的返回值,而不是返回None。如果函数没有返回值,你可以对函数的返回值进行检查,以确保它不是None,然后再使用它的属性或方法。
总之,当你遇到AttributeError: 'NoneType' object has no attribute 'to_csv'错误时,你需要检查是不是在对一个None对象进行操作,或者在函数的返回值上调用属性或方法。确保对象不是None,并且函数有明确的返回值,以避免这个错误的发生。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[Python 中 AttributeError: ‘NoneType‘ object has no attribute ‘X‘ 错误](https://blog.csdn.net/fengqianlang/article/details/129674118)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
阅读全文
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20241231044930.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)